What Is IFSC Code and Why Is It Important?

IFSC stands for Indian Financial System Code, an 11-character alphanumeric code provided by the Reserve Bank of India. Every bank branch, along with Central Bank Of India located in Datha, Bhavnagar, Gujarat, are given a unique IFSC like CBIN0280558 to ensure that online payments reach the right destination.

The IFSC Code is important because:

  • It clearly tells which bank branch it is in Bhavnagar.
  • It helps NEFT, RTGS, and IMPS systems route the transfer securely.
  • It prevents any kind of confusion between different branches of the same bank in places like Bhavnagar and Datha.
  • It reduces errors in fund transfers and improves accuracy.
  • It helps the sender banks to validate and confirm branch details before processing payments.

Format of the IFSC Code CBIN0280558

The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Central Bank Of India, has an 11-character structure:

AAAA0CCCCCC

Here's the breakdown:

  • First 4 characters (AAAA): Show the bank code. For Central Bank Of India, these letters represent the bank's short name.
  • 5th character: Is always zero and is kept for future use.
  •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): Represent the specific branch code assigned to branches such as Datha in Bhavnagar.
